3 Usual Causes of Water Spots on Walls


As opposed to popular belief, water discolorations on wall surfaces do not always come from bad building materials. There are a number of reasons for water stains on walls. These consist of:

Poor Drain


This will stop water from permeating right into the wall surfaces. This links to excessive wetness that you observe on the wall surfaces of your structure.
The leading reason of damp wall surfaces, in this instance, can be a bad drainage system. It can additionally result from inadequate management of sewer pipes that run through the structure.

Wet


When hot wet air consults with dry cool air, it creates water droplets to form on the wall surfaces of buildings. This takes place in bathroom and kitchens when there is steam from food preparation or showers. The water beads can tarnish the surrounding walls in these parts of your house as well as spread to various other locations.
Damp or condensation impacts the roofing system and also wall surfaces of structures. When the wall is wet, it produces an appropriate environment for the growth of microbes as well as fungi.

Pipeline Leaks


Most houses have a network of pipes within the walls. This guarantees that the pipelines are well away from the reach of damaging rodents. It always raises the practicality of such pipes, as there is little oxygen within the wall surfaces. This inhibits corrosion.
Yet, a drawback to this is that water leak impacts the wall surfaces of the building and causes widespread damage. An indicator of malfunctioning pipes is the appearance of a water tarnish on the wall.

    Stains on the Walls and Ceilings


    If you see patches of paint discoloration or obvious stains on your walls and ceilings, that is a clear sign of water damage in your home. Do not try to paint over these stains, as that is not a fix and the issue will often resurface through the new paint. In some cases, if you paint over a water stain it will resurface over a larger area of the affected wall or ceiling.



    That is why you need to immediately call in a water damage cleanup specialist if you see stains on the walls and ceilings. In many cases, this can be caused by a hidden plumbing issue that will need immediate attention.


    Flaking or Peeling Paint


    Similar to ceiling and wall stains, peeling or flaking paint is a major tell that your home is experiencing water damage. When your drywall is exposed to excess moisture, the moisture will try to escape through the wall or ceiling, which in turn will cause the paint to lift off its surface. This is due to the fact that walls tend to absorb any and all moisture like a sponge. As a result, water damage near any drywall can spread quite easily.


    Soft or Swollen Drywall


    Water damage, when left unaddressed, can often cause walls and ceilings to appear swollen. In some extreme cases, the swelling can eventually cause your ceiling to sag. This can potentially be hazardous to anything fragile in your home, as well as put your family in danger.


    How Do I Test For Water Damage or Leaks?


  • Turn off all water in your home. This includes faucets, appliances that use water (such as a freezer that makes ice), and any other water outlet in your house.


  • Go to your water meter and write down the usage statistics


  • Wait 3 hours with the water off, and then go to the water meter and check the water usage statistics again.


  • If your water usage has gone up in any way over the span of three hours with all of your water turned off, then you have a water leak somewhere in your home.
